What is a Milliliter?
Milliliters measure volume and are used worldwide for cooking and baking. For water at room temperature, 1 ml weighs approximately 1 gram, but this relationship does not hold for other ingredients.

First convert ounces to grams (1 ounce = 28.3495g), then divide by 218 (grams per cup), then multiply by 236.588 to get milliliters. For 15.99 ounces: 15.99 × 28.3495 = 453.31g, then 453.31 ÷ 218 = 2.08 cups × 236.588 = 491.96 ml.
For the most accurate results, weigh vegetable oil on a kitchen scale. If measuring by volume, use a liquid measuring cup on a flat surface and read the level at eye height.
Temperature has a minimal effect on most cooking liquids. The density of vegetable oil changes slightly with temperature, but the difference is usually less than 1-2% between refrigerator and room temperature. This conversion assumes room temperature.
